How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Newtonsville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Newtonsville Studio Apartments | $1,024 | $745 | $1,160 |
Newtonsville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,325 | $899 | $1,919 |
Newtonsville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,719 | $1,000 | $3,175 |
Newtonsville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,722 | $1,356 | $2,700 |
Newtonsville 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,298 | $1,706 | $4,800 |

Largest Available Newtonsville and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Newtonsville, OH is found at River Ridge in the Hearthstone Estates neighborhood and is 880 square feet priced from $1,643. Avalon at the Pointe in the Liberty Crossing neighborhood has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 811 square feet and currently listed start at $1,465. Here is today’s list of the largest available 1 Bedroom units in Newtonsville: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
River Ridge | Berkley | 880 Sq Ft | $1,643 |
Avalon at the Pointe | A-7 | 811 Sq Ft | $1,465 |
LakePointe Apartments | Viola | 790 Sq Ft | $1,396 |
Bells Lake Apartments | 1 Bedroom | 750 Sq Ft | $1,025 |
Loveland Station Apartments | A2 | 700 Sq Ft | $1,550 |
8Ninety at Loveland | Schwinn | 685 Sq Ft | $1,425 |
Residence at Milford Tower | 1 Bedroom | 650 Sq Ft | $945 |
Arrowhead Apartments | Riesling | 645 Sq Ft | $1,053 |
Fieldchase Senior Apartments | One Bed | 625 Sq Ft | $1,595 |
Union Commons | A1-R 60% | 607 Sq Ft | $1,143 |
Cheapest Available Newtonsville and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ments
As of June 12,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Newtonsville, OH is the One Bedroom One Bath Apartment Model starting from $899 at Daniel Court in the Wetherby Farms neighborhood. The second most affordable Newtonsville 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bedroom Model at Residence at Milford Tower starting at $945 in the Ashton Woods ne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Newtonsville is currently $1,325.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Newtonsville: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
Daniel Court | One Bedroom One Bath Apartment | $899 |
Residence at Milford Tower | 1 Bedroom | $945 |
Maplewood | 1Bed/1Bath | $975 |
Bells Lake Apartments | 1 Bedroom | $1,025 |
Arrowhead Apartments | Riesling | $1,053 |
Timbercrest Apartments | 1 Bed, 1 bath | $1,100 |
Union Commons | A1-R 60% | $1,143 |
Avalon at the Pointe | A-3 | $1,295 |
LakePointe Apartments | Senna | $1,301 |
8Ninety at Loveland | Schwinn | $1,425 |
